Lima, April 4, 2024.- A big step for Chinecas. The Private Investment Promotion Agency (PROINVERSIÓN) signed with the “Consorcio LSH Consulting Engineers S.A.C. – Agua Energía y Minería Ingenieros Consultores S.A.” (Peruvian-German companies) the contract to prepare pre-investment studies to define the viability and investment mechanism of the Chinecas irrigation project in Ancash.
The subscription of the contract was attended by the Deputy Minister of Family Agriculture, Agricultural Infrastructure, and Irrigation Development, Christian Barrantes, the regional governor of Ancash, Fabian Koki Noriega and the executive director of PROINVESIÓN, José Salardi.
With this, PROINVERSIÓN, together with the Ministries of Economy and Finance (MEF) and Agricultural Development and Irrigation (MIDAGRI), as well as the Regional Government of Ancash, take an important step towards making this mega irrigation project a reality, which could increase agro-industrial production by US$ 1.5 billion annually and generate 150,000 new jobs.
The pre-investment studies will be carried out within 14 months and will allow the declaration of viability of the project to be obtained. On this basis, the evaluation report will be prepared that will define whether the project is developed through a Public-Private Partnership (PPP) within the framework of a promotion process or goes as a public work.
If the first scenario occurs, PROINVERSIÓN would be in charge of designing and conducting the structuring and transaction phases of the project, as well as the tender that will allow the awarding of the development of Chinecas to a specialized concessionaire.
The project will require an investment of more than US$ 700 million, allowing water to be diverted from the Santa River to incorporate 50,000 hectares of new land and improve irrigation on another 33,000 hectares in the valleys and intervalleys of Santa Lacramarca, Nepeña, Casma and Huarmey. Likewise, the resource will be used for the supply of population use in the localities within the area of influence and in the hydroelectric exploitation that is viable.
Currently, the Chinecas project has a set of works built and in operation, these are two water intakes in the Santa River, canals and tunnels with an extension to the Nepeña Valley. Meanwhile, a new main water intake and reservoirs will be built to regulate the waters of the Santa River and the extension of its main canals to the Casma and Huarmey valleys;
The project’s new infrastructure and the improvement of existing works will provide year-round water, facilitating the development of modern agriculture for the country.
The contract was signed within the framework of the inter-institutional agreement signed in 2023 between PROINVERSIÓN and the Regional Government of Ancash through which the agency is responsible for the selection, contracting and monitoring of the pre-investment technical studies, supervision and the Evaluation Report.
By virtue of the agreement, all PROINVERSIÓN interventions will be carried out in coordination with the Regional Government of Ancash and the Chinecas Special Project, which during the study stage will be constituted as the Project Formulation Unit.
